Edinburgh Montessori Arts School Nursery adheres to the statutory ratios set by Care Inspectorate Scotland. These regulations ensure every child receives appropriate supervision based on their age: under 2 years 1:3, 2 to 3 years 1:5, and 3 to 8 years 1:8. In sessional care settings where children attend for fewer than 4 hours daily, a ratio of 1:10 may apply for those aged 3 and over.

Edinburgh Montessori Arts School Nursery follows the national nutritional standards outlined in the Scottish Government's Setting the Table guidance. This framework ensures that all meals and snacks are nutritionally balanced for children from birth to age 5. To maintain safety, Edinburgh Montessori Arts School Nursery records all medical and cultural dietary needs upon registration. The nursery adheres to Care Inspectorate Scotland standards by sharing this information with all staff involved in food handling. Mealtimes are managed to prevent cross-contamination, often utilizing visual aids or individual care plans to ensure children with allergies receive safe and appropriate alternatives.
